Robotic Surgery Market
Robotic Surgery Market Forecasts to 2034 - Global Analysis By Component (Robotic Systems, Accessories & Instruments, and Services), Surgery Type, Robot Type, Technology, Application, End User and By Geography
According to Stratistics MRC, the Global Robotic Surgery Market is accounted for $8.4 billion in 2026 and is expected to reach $26.7 billion by 2034, growing at a CAGR of 15.5% during the forecast period. Robotic Surgery refers to minimally invasive surgical procedures performed with the assistance of computer-controlled robotic systems that translate a surgeon's hand movements into precise instrument actions within the patient's body. These systems comprise a surgeon console, patient cart with robotic arms, and advanced imaging components that deliver magnified, high-definition visualization. By enhancing surgical dexterity, reducing tremor, and enabling access to confined anatomical spaces, robotic surgery improves procedural accuracy, diminishes postoperative complications, and accelerates patient recovery across a wide spectrum of surgical specialties.
Market Dynamics:
Driver:
Growing preference for minimally invasive surgical procedures and improved patient outcomes
Patients and clinical institutions increasingly favor minimally invasive surgery for its association with reduced blood loss, shorter hospital stays, lower infection risk, and faster return to normal activity. Robotic systems deliver a level of precision and control that surpasses traditional laparoscopic instruments, enabling surgeons to perform complex procedures with greater confidence. The expanding evidence base demonstrating superior clinical outcomes in urological, gynecological, and general surgery applications is accelerating adoption across both academic medical centers and community hospitals. As awareness grows among both surgeons and patients, the procedural volume supported by robotic platforms continues to rise.
Restraint:
Prohibitive capital cost and high maintenance expenditure of robotic surgical systems
The acquisition of a robotic surgical system requires a multimillion-dollar upfront investment, creating a substantial financial barrier particularly for community hospitals and healthcare providers in emerging markets. Beyond initial procurement, ongoing costs including instrument replacement, software licensing, service contracts, and surgical training programs impose a heavy recurrent financial burden. Reimbursement frameworks in many healthcare systems have not kept pace with the actual cost of robotic procedures, compressing hospital margins. These economic constraints limit the diffusion of robotic surgery beyond large tertiary centers, slowing the overall pace of market penetration despite strong clinical advocacy.
Opportunity:
Emergence of AI-integrated and autonomous surgical robotic platforms
The convergence of artificial intelligence with robotic surgery is opening transformative possibilities including intraoperative guidance, real-time tissue recognition, and procedure-specific decision support. AI integration enables robotic systems to learn from thousands of surgical videos, flagging anatomical risks and suggesting optimal instrument trajectories. Semi-autonomous capabilities where the robot assists with defined subtasks while the surgeon retains full control are advancing through clinical validation pipelines. These innovations are expected to reduce procedure times, lower complications, and extend the capabilities of less-experienced surgeons, significantly broadening the addressable market and making robotic surgery viable across a wider range of hospitals and surgical specialties.
Threat:
Regulatory and liability uncertainties surrounding autonomous surgical functionalities
As robotic surgery platforms incorporate increasingly autonomous features, regulatory agencies face the challenge of establishing appropriate approval frameworks for AI-driven surgical decision-making. The absence of clear classification guidelines for semi-autonomous surgical functions creates market entry uncertainty for developers and prolonged approval timelines. Simultaneously, questions of legal liability in cases of adverse outcomes attributable to AI-driven actions rather than direct surgeon decisions remain unresolved in most jurisdictions. These regulatory ambiguities dampen investor confidence and slow commercialization of next-generation platforms, representing a structural headwind that the industry must collectively address through evidence-based advocacy and stakeholder engagement.
Covid-19 Impact:
The COVID-19 pandemic temporarily suppressed elective surgical volumes as hospitals prioritized infectious disease management, causing a short-term contraction in robotic surgery procedure counts and system installations. However, the crisis underscored the value of robotic platforms in enabling reduced-contact surgical environments and demonstrated their role in maintaining certain essential surgeries safely during the pandemic period. As elective procedure volumes rebounded post-pandemic, pent-up surgical demand fueled accelerated platform adoption. The crisis also highlighted the importance of surgical efficiency and infection control, reinforcing the long-term clinical and operational rationale for robotic surgery investment.

Region with largest share:
During the forecast period, the North America region is expected to hold the largest market share, supported by high healthcare expenditure, widespread insurance reimbursement coverage for robotic procedures, and a dense network of academic medical centers that champion surgical innovation. The United States hosts the largest installed base of surgical robotic systems globally and leads in the number of robotic procedures performed annually across urology, gynecology, and general surgery. Robust FDA approval pathways and strong clinical advocacy communities continue to drive new system introductions, sustaining the region's leadership throughout the forecast horizon.
Region with highest CAGR:
Over the forecast period, the Asia Pacific region is anticipated to exhibit the highest CAGR, reflecting rapid hospital infrastructure expansion in China, India, South Korea, and Southeast Asia. Government health modernization programs and growing medical tourism are stimulating hospital investment in advanced surgical technologies. Rising surgical volumes driven by aging populations and increasing chronic disease burden create significant demand for efficient, precise surgical solutions. Local manufacturers are also entering the robotic surgery space with cost-competitive platforms tailored for regional markets, further broadening accessibility and adoption across the Asia Pacific region.

Key Developments:
In March 2026, Medtronic plc announced a strategic collaboration with a leading medical imaging firm to integrate real-time intraoperative imaging capabilities into its Hugo robotic-assisted surgery platform, aimed at improving anatomical visualization and expanding the system's clinical application across urological and gynecological surgical specialties.
In January 2026, Intuitive Surgical received FDA clearance for its next-generation da Vinci 5 robotic surgical system featuring enhanced force feedback capabilities and integrated AI-powered intraoperative guidance, enabling surgeons to perform complex minimally invasive procedures with greater precision and improved tactile sensory information during tissue manipulation.
